Officer Responsibilities
Job Descriptions & Conference Responsibilities


Conference Steering Committee:  The Conference Steering Committee, made up of all IAEA board members, plan
and run the conference activities.    

Project Director/Coordinator: President is responsible for all conference, reception and gallery tour organization,
coordination and management including keynote speaker and hands-on workshop presenter recruitment *. President
also maintains the IAEA website.

Conference Budget Administrator: Treasurer is responsible for membership fee collection, conference
pre-registration and on-site registration as well as grant budget reporting to the grant follow-up report writer.  
Treasurer is responsible for all financial record keeping for IAEA including making payments and deposits.

Vendor Recruitment, Minutes and Conference Correspondence: Secretary coordinates vendors and donations,
sends thank-you letters to vendors, takes minutes of meetings and maintain records of all correspondence before,
during and after the conference.

Conference Community Art Project, Raffle and Silent Auction, Educator of the Year Awards: President-Elect
coordinates the community art project, raffle and silent auction and educator of the year awards*.

Conference Publicity, Documentation, Grant Writing and Credits: Vice President coordinates conference publicity
and publications as well as the digital recording* of the keynote panel, various workshops and conference activities.  
Vice President is also responsible for grant writing and providing information for the follow-up report in addition to
applying for college credits for the conference (at least 6 months before the conference) and posting teacher grades
after the completion of the conference.

Newsletter Editor: Editor works with the President to publish and distribute the IAEA newsletters containing pre-
and post-conference information, subscriptions and registration forms**.


* Responsibilities for conference, reception and gallery tour organization, coordination and management including
keynote speaker and hands-on workshop presenter recruitment were shared between VP and President for 2005
conference.  (In the past, the President-Elect was also heavily involved in these responsibilities).  Conference
publicity, publications and documentation was shared with President for 2005 conference.  The community art
project, silent auction and educator of the year awards were coordinated by the VP for 2005 conference.

** Newsletter responsibilities were handled by President for 2004 and 2005.
